German POW Quest

I am researching the story of an allied Pilot who was subjected to investigation by the S.I.B. in 1945. A witness against him was listed as KRUMBIEGEL P.O.W. Clearly he was a German who provided some evidence, my quest is to see if any member has a listing of German pow's to see if the name appears. Sadly this is the only information I have, can anyone help please. Thank you in advance for any thoughts.
